Portrait of Words - Writing Guidelines


Welcome to my monthly writing challenge known as a "Portrait of Words".

In a nut shell here's how it works. Each Month I'll give you a set of categories along with photographs to use as inspiration for your story. Look at each of the pictures and interpret them, then create a story based on what you see and feel. It's really that simple. Listed below are more specific details to help guide you through the process.

The most important thing to remember is this: It's supposed to be a fun experience for everyone, and viewed simply as a writing exercise designed to stimulate creativity and camaraderie between fellow bloggers. In other words, don't get too bogged down with the rules. Use them as guidelines to help you, not to confine you.


~~~

The Categories:

Main Character(s): Your story can be told through or about this person(s), i.e. first or third person. Either way you go, their involvement in the story should be a focal point. Have as many or as few additional characters as you wish, but at least one of the ones pictured should be central to the overall story.

Backdrop: This will create the setting for your story. It can take place at the location depicted, be a destination to it, or be a journey from it.

Purpose: This is what drives or motivates the main character(s) to action. It can also be viewed as the objective of the story. (EDIT - this category has been removed this month - February)

Item(s): The object(s) should have a significant value to the main character, backdrop or purpose of the story.

Wild Card: Writers choice here. Choose *one* of the three options to use in your story anyway you see fit.

~~~

General Guidelines:

Your story can be of any length or style. Long or short, comedy or tragedy, fact or fiction, etc,etc... it's up to you.

Use each of the picture representations from the Main Character, Backdrop, Purpose and Item categories in your story. Use only one from the wild card options.
